Brendan Schaub vs. Lavar Johnson official for UFC 157

Brendan Schaub and Lavar Johnson were scheduled to face each other at UFC on FOX 5 before Johnson had to pull out of the fight with an injury.UFC 157 Full Poster

The bout will now happen at UFC 157 on February 23rd in California as UFC officials announced the fight booking on Wednesday.

Schaub (8-3) is currently on a two fight losing streak with both of those losses coming by knockout. His last win came at UFC 128 against Mirko Cro Cop in the beginning of 2011 and he will be looking for his fifth UFC victory at UFC 157.

During his career, Schaub has finished seven of his opponents by knockout and three of his four victories in the UFC have come by TKO/KO.

Johnson (17-6) entered the UFC earlier this year after being in Strikeforce and opened his UFC career with back to back victories. Those victories came against Joey Beltran and Pat Barry, with the end of the first coming in the first round by knockout. In both of those wins, he won the knockout of the night bonus.

After starting 2-0 in the UFC, he was booked to face Stefan Struve at UFC 146 and he was defeated by submission in the first round. It was his fifth career lost by submission and his first lost since Shawn Jordan submitted him in Strikeforce.

UFC 157 takes place on February 23rd at the Honda Center in Anaheim, California and will be headlined by Ronda Rousey defending the UFC women’s bantamweight title against Liz Carmouche.
